Table 2.

Comparable items between the UPDRS-III and Body Motion Evaluation.

Functional modalities UPDRS-III items BME items Description of BME items
Upper extremity Rigidity (upper limbs 3.3) Shoulder flexion (right and left) All are range of motion, measured in degrees
Body bradykinesia (3.14) Shoulder extension (right and left)
Shoulder internal/external rotation (right and left)
Maximum shoulder abduction (right and left)

Lower extremity Rigidity (lower limbs 3.3) Bilateral squat depth All measured in centimeters and inches
Gait (3.10) Lunge distance (right and left)
Body bradykinesia (3.14)

Trunk Rigidity (neck 3.3) Trunk rotation (right and left) All measured in degrees
Posture (3.13) Trunk flexion
Trunk extension

Balance and posture Postural stability (3.12) Anterior-posterior hip displacement Patients were asked to remain for 10 seconds with arms outstretched to the sides, eyes closed, and head tilted upward
Posture (3.13) Medial-lateral hip displacement Hip displacement was measured in centimeters

Gait Arising from a chair (3.9) Cadence Strides/minute
Gait (3.10) Gait speed Meters/second
Freezing of gait (3.11) Stride length Centimeters
Posture (3.13) Step length (right and left) Centimeters
Body bradykinesia (3.14) Step width (right and left) Centimeters

BME, Body Motion Evaluation; UPDRS-III, Unified Parkinson's Disease Rating Scale.
